Duluth, Minn — The Duluth Huskies Baseball Club would like to thank the Northland for voting for the Duluth Huskies in the Duluth News Tribune’s Best of the Best for 2018. 205,988 votes were cast and on September 3rd, the results were announced. Duluth’s locally owned, baseball team came in 2nd place for “The best local sports team”! In first place was UM Duluth’s Men’s Hockey team and in third was the Harbor City Roller Dame’s.
The Duluth Huskies’ best season yet ended on August 17th at Wade Stadium after 72 regular season games and 5 post season games. Be sure to stay tuned for Huskies off-season events and accomplishments by following the Huskies’ website and social media.

The Duluth Huskies are a member of the finest developmental league for elite college baseball players, the Northwoods League. Now in its 25th anniversary season, the Northwoods League is the largest organized baseball league in the world with 20 teams, drawing significantly more fans, in a friendly ballpark experience, than any league of its kind. A valuable training ground for coaches, umpires and front office staff, over 200 former Northwoods League players have advanced to Major League Baseball, including three-time Cy Young Award winner Max Scherzer (WAS), two-time World Series Champions Ben Zobrist (CHC) and Brandon Crawford (SFG) and MLB All-Stars Chris Sale (BOS), Jordan Zimmermann (DET) and Curtis Granderson (TOR).
